Far Cry Primal Promotion In Europe Invites Fans To Sleep In A Cave

For the upcoming prehistoric flavored Far Cry: Primal, which launches on the PS4, Xbox One, and PC in February, Ubisoft is holding one of their typically wacky promotions to make sure people are talking about the game. What is it this time? Well, to promote their game that is about cavemen, they are inviting you to be a cave man. Yep, the newest promotion invites fans to live in a cave for an evening.

To participate in this contest, you a tweet to @FarCryPrimal mentioning #cavebnb, explaining why exactly you are daft enough to want to spend a night in a cave in the middle of winter. If you do win this, you get to take a friend with you to the Pyrénées in France, stay in a hotel in Lourdes, get professional survival training, stay in a “€500” a night cave, and then get travel back the following day.

So… yeah, that’s actually as crazy as it sounds.
